QYLE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2024 in Review

2 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Global X Nasdaq 100 ESG Covered Call ETF (QYLE) for Q4 2024, worth a combined $236K — down 76% from $963K a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 2 funds closed out of QYLE and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 1 trimmed existing stakes and 0 added.

The largest seller was Jane Street, exiting entirely with an estimated $573K sold.
